3. Modern Marina Facilities
Japan boasts some of the most advanced marinas in the world, equipped with state-of-the-art amenities and services. Facilities such as Nishinomiya Marina and Tokyo Bay Marina offer comprehensive services to yachters, including maintenance, refueling, and provisioning. Many marinas also provide easy access to urban areas, making it convenient for sailors to explore and enjoy the local culture.
4. Diverse Sailing Conditions
The variety of sailing conditions across Japan's waters caters to both novice and experienced sailors. From the calm seas of the Inland Sea to the challenging winds off the Pacific coast, yacht enthusiasts can find the perfect conditions that suit their skill level. Moreover, the changing seasons present different challenges and beautiful scenery, making each sailing season unique.
